On Fri, Aug 29, 2003 at 08:14:36PM +1200, Volker Kuhlmann wrote: > > me to use win at some point. If fat32 is the problem, is there another > > lin/win compatible FS that is able to take > 2GiB files?
> Not really. Can anyone confirm that the fat32 limit is indeed 2GB? The limit is (2^32)-1, refer to [0]. > You can get ext2 drivers for M$, but they're commercial and not cheap > (google for it). The original poster could try ext2FSd (which is alpha software), or may be able to get away with using something like Explore2FS.
